body {
	color: #000;
	background: #f9faff url(../Images/chaos-mini2.png) 50% 120px no-repeat;
	margin: 0 auto;
}

#center-wrap {
max-width: 1024px;margin: 0 auto;
}

h1, h2, h3, h4, h5, h6 {
	color: #000;
}

a#logo {
	color: #000;
	font-size: 36px;
	font-weight: bold;
	text-decoration: none;
	float: left;
	padding: 20px 0 0 0;
}

div.container {
	min-height: 600px;
	padding: 10px 0 0 0;
}

div#main {float: left;}

div#placeholder-footer {padding: 10px 0;}

div#nav div#placeholder-nav {
}

div#hero div#placeholder-hero {
	background-color: transparent;
}

div#hero-sub div.inner {
	background-color: #f4f4f4;
	color: #a3a3a3;
	font-size: 11px;
}

div#footer {
	border-top: 1px dotted #a3a3a3;

}

td.menu-item {
	color: #a4a4a4;	
}

td.menu-item-hover {
	color: #537f31;
}

td.menu-item-selected {
	color: #fffc00;
}

td.submenu-item {
	background: #f9f9f9;
	color: #000;
	font-size: 11px;
	padding: 6px !important;
}

td.submenu-item-hover {
	background: #4A8797;
	color: #fff;
	font-size: 11px;
	padding: 6px !important;
}

td.submenu-item-selected {
	background: #000;
	color: #fff;
	font-size: 11px;
	padding: 6px !important;
}

/* @group Forms */

.product-form h3 {
	font-size: 14px;
	padding-left: 9px;
}

.product-form {
	margin-bottom: 18px;
}

.secure-login, .newsletter-form {
	background: #f9f9f9;
	border: 1px solid #f2f2f2;
	margin-bottom: 18px;
}

.secure-login h3, .newsletter-form h3 {
	background: #eee;
	border-bottom: 1px solid #eee;
	font-size: 14px;
	margin: 0;
	padding: 6px 18px;
}

.secure-login div.form, .newsletter-form div.form {
	padding-left: 9px;
}

#placeholder-nav table td {cursor: pointer; }    /* @end */

/* @group Links */

a:link, a:visited {
	color: #1458aa;
	text-decoration: none;	
}

a:hover, a:active {
	color: #4A8797;
	text-decoration: underline;
}

div#hero-sub a:link, div#hero-sub a:visited {
	color: #69BFDE;
	text-decoration: none;		
}

div#hero-sub a:hover, div#hero-sub a:active {
	color: #69BFDE;
	text-decoration: none;		
}

#placeholder-nav table td {cursor: pointer; }    /* @end */



/* @group Template Settings */

div#header-left img {
	margin: 0;
	float: left;
}

div#header-left, div.whoslogged, div#header-right {
	height: 77px;
	line-height: 77px;
}

div.whoslogged {
	text-align: right;
}

div#placeholder-search {
	padding: 46px 40px 0 0;
	text-align: right;
}

div#placeholder-search input.cat_textbox_small {
	width: 130px;
}

div#nav div#placeholder-nav {
	height: 36px;
}

div#placeholder-nav {
	padding-left: 18px;
}

div#placeholder-nav td {
	padding: 0;
	vertical-align: middle;
}

div#hero {
	margin-right: 0;
	width: 600px;
}

div#hero div#placeholder-hero {
	overflow: hidden;
}

div#hero div#placeholder-hero, div#hero-sub div.inner {
	height: 216px;
}

div#hero-sub div.inner {
background: #fff;
}

div#hero-sub div.pad {
	padding: 18px;
}

div#main div.inner, div#sub div.inner {
	padding: 18px 0 36px;
}

div#placeholder-rss {
	height: 16px;
	margin-bottom: 9px;
	text-align: right;
}

div#placeholder-rss img {
	margin: 0 9px;
	vertical-align: middle;
}

div#footer {
	padding-top: 18px;
	height: 72px ;
}

#placeholder-nav table td {cursor: pointer; }    /* @end */

h2#placeholder-logo { 
margin: 30px 0 0 0;
font-family: Georgia, "Times New Roman", Times, serif;
line-height: 1em;
}

h2#placeholder-logo span { 
float: left;
}

h2#placeholder-logo a {font-size: 90%;color: #a9a9a9;}

.sub_title {margin: 0;}

#nav, #nav ul {
	float: left;
	width: auto;
	list-style: none;
	line-height: 1;
	background: white;
	font-weight: bold;
	padding: 0;
	margin: 0 0 .5em 0;
}

#nav a {
	display: block;
	width: auto;
	w\idth: auto;
	color: #7C6240;
	text-decoration: none;
	padding: 0.35em .5em;
}

#nav a.daddy {
	background: url(rightarrow2.gif) center right no-repeat;
}

#nav li {
	float: left;
	padding: 0;
	width: auto;
	text-align: center;
}

#nav li ul {
	position: absolute;
	left: -999em;
	height: auto;
	width: auto;
	w\idth: auto;
	font-weight: normal;
	border-width: 0.25em;
	margin: 0;
}

#nav li li {
	padding-right: 1em;
	width: 13em
}

#nav li ul a {
	width: 13em;
	w\idth: 9em;
}

#nav li ul ul {
	margin: -1.75em 0 0 14em;
}

ul.productfeaturelist {
list-style: none;
}

li.productItem {
height: 100px;
}

#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ul {
	left: -999em;
}

#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ul {
	left: auto;
}

#nav li:hover, #nav li.sfhover {
	background: #eda;
}

.date {margin: 0;font-size: 85%;}
.img19 {float: left; width: 310px; padding: 10px 0;}
.text19 {float: left; width: auto;}

#nav_432287, #nav_432287 ul {padding:1em 0 0 0;margin:0;list-style:none;line-height:1.0em;}
#nav_432287 a {display:block;width:10em;font-family:Verdana, Arial;font-size:10pt;text-align:left;color:black;text-decoration:none;}
#nav_432287 li {float:left;width:auto;border-width:0px;border-style:none;border-color:black;padding:1em;}
#nav_432287 li:hover, li.sfhover {background-color:#f2f2f2;border-width:0px;border-style:none;border-color:black;}
#nav_432287 li:hover a, #nav_432287 li.sfhover a {font-family:Verdana, Arial;font-size:10pt;color:black;text-decoration:none;}
#nav_432287 li ul {position:absolute; left: -999em;margin-top: 0.0em;width:10em;}
#nav_432287 li ul li {background-color:#fff;border-width:0px;border-style:none;border-color:black;padding:0;}
#nav_432287 li ul a {float:left;padding:1em;font-family:Verdana, Arial;font-size:10pt;text-align:left;color:black;text-decoration:none;}
#nav_432287 li:hover ul, #nav_432287 li.sfhover ul {left: auto;}
#nav_432287 li ul ul {margin: -0.9em 0 0 10.0em;}
#nav_432287 li:hover ul ul, #nav_432287 li.sfhover ul ul{ left: -999em; }
#nav_432287 li li:hover ul, #nav_432287 li li.sfhover ul{ left: auto; }
#nav_432287 li ul li:hover #nav_432287 li ul li.sfhover {padding:1em;background-color:blue;border-width:0px;border-style:none;border-color:black;}
#nav_432287 li ul li:hover a, #nav_432287 li ul li.sfhover a {font-family:Verdana, Arial;font-size:10pt;color:black;text-decoration:none;} *+html #nav_432287 li hover, *+html #nav_432287 li.sfhover { position: static; }
*+html #nav_432287 li:hover ul ul, *+html #nav_432287 li.sfhover ul ul{ position: static; } 
#nav_432287 li img {vertical-align:middle;} 


#cat_1157010_divs {
	float:left;
	margin:0 0 0 40px;
}



#nav_1157010, #nav_1157010 ul {padding:0;margin:0;list-style:none;}
#nav_1157010 a {display:block;font-family:Verdana, Arial;font-size:10pt;text-align:left;color:black;text-decoration:none;line-height:0}
#nav_1157010 li {float:left;width:auto;border-width:0px;border-style:none;border-color:black;padding:1.5em;background-color:#f9faff; margin:0 2px 0 0;line-height:0;}
#nav_1157010 li:hover, li.sfhover {background: transparent url(/images/fade_bg.png) center right repeat;border-width:0px;border-style:none;border-color:black;}
#nav_1157010 li:hover a, #nav_1157010 li.sfhover a {font-family:Verdana, Arial;font-size:10pt;color:black;text-decoration:none;}
#nav_1157010 li ul {position:absolute; left: -999em;margin-top: 1.25em;width:10em;display:none;}
#nav_1157010 li ul li {background-color:#fff;border-width:0px;border-style:none;border-color:black;padding:0;}
#nav_1157010 li ul a {float:left;padding:1em;font-family:Verdana, Arial;font-size:10pt;text-align:left;color:black;text-decoration:none;}
#nav_1157010 li:hover ul, #nav_1157010 li.sfhover ul {left: auto;}
#nav_1157010 li ul ul {margin: -0.9em 0 0 10.0em;}
#nav_1157010 li:hover ul ul, #nav_1157010 li.sfhover ul ul{ left: -999em; }
#nav_1157010 li li:hover ul, #nav_1157010 li li.sfhover ul{ left: auto; }
#nav_1157010 li ul li:hover #nav_1157010 li ul li.sfhover {padding:1em;background-color:blue;border-width:0px;border-style:none;border-color:black;}
#nav_1157010 li ul li:hover a, #nav_1157010 li ul li.sfhover a {font-family:Verdana, Arial;font-size:10pt;color:black;text-decoration:none;} *+html #nav_1157010 li hover, *+html #nav_1157010 li.sfhover { position: static; }
*+html #nav_1157010 li:hover ul ul, *+html #nav_1157010 li.sfhover ul ul{ position: static; } 
#nav_1157010 li img {vertical-align:middle;} 





#wrapper {
padding: 20px 0 0 0;
float: left;
width: 100%;
text-align:center;
}

#content {
	background: transparent url(/images/fade_bg.png) center right repeat;
float: left;
width: 532px;
padding: 40px;
margin: 0 0 20px 0;
text-align:center;
}

#content h1,h2,h3,h4,h5,h6,p,ul,ol {
	text-align:left;
}

.the-list {
text-align: left;
padding:0 20px;
}

.the-list li {
padding: 10px 0 0 0;
}

#showcase-content {
	background: transparent url(/images/fade_bg.png) center right repeat;
float: left;
width: 532px;
padding: 40px;
margin: 0 0 2% 0;
text-align: center;
}

.ln-aft {
margin: 0 0 2px 0;
}

.ln-aft2 {
margin: 0 0 5px 0;
}

#bstyle {
	background: transparent url(/images/fade_bg.png) center right repeat;
float: left;
width: 220px;
padding: 40px;text-align:left;
}

#contact {
	background: transparent url(/images/fade_bg.png) center right repeat;
float: right;
padding: 40px;
width: 220px;text-align:left;
}

.photogalleryTable {
width: 98%;
}

#hd {
float: left;
width: 100%;
}

#ft {
float: left;
width: 100%;
}

.ft-img {
opacity: 1.0;
}

.rght_img {
padding: 3% 0% 3% 3%;
float: right;
}

.lft_img {
padding: 3% 3% 3% 0%;
float: left;
}

.scl_icns {
	text-align:right;
	padding:0 40px 0 0;
	margin:0;
	float:right;
	line-height:0;
}

.mn-nav {
	list-style:none;
	display:block;
	float:left;
	margin:0;
	padding:0 40px;
}

.mn-nav li {
	list-style:none;
	display:block;
	float:left;
	padding:10px;
	background: #f9faff;
	margin:0 3px 0 0;
}

.mn-nav li:hover, .select-tab,#nav_1157010 li.selected {
	background: transparent url(/images/fade_bg.png) center right repeat;
}

.button6 {
	text-align:right;
}

#the_19 {
}

.site_info {
	text-align:center;
	background:url("/images/fade_bg.png") repeat scroll right center transparent;
	padding:3px;
font-size:90%;
}

.works {
	float:left;
	width:auto;
}


.blog-container {
	text-align:left;
	float:left;
	width:100%;
clear:both;
	}
	
.BlogTagList, .BlogTagList ul {
	display:block;float:left;
}

div.thumb {
float:left;
width:100px;
height:100px;
overflow:hidden;
text-align:center;
margin:0 20px 20px 0;
}

	
.thumb img {
margin:-50% 0 0 -50%;
}
	
	
/*
 * jQuery Nivo Slider v2.4
 * http://nivo.dev7studios.com
 *
 * Copyright 2011, Gilbert Pellegrom
 * Free to use and abuse under the MIT license.
 * http://www.opensource.org/licenses/mit-license.php
 * 
 * March 2010
 */
 
 
/* The Nivo Slider styles */
.nivoSlider {
	position:relative;
}
.nivoSlider img {
	position:absolute;
	top:0px;
	left:0px;
}
/* If an image is wrapped in a link */
.nivoSlider a.nivo-imageLink {
	position:absolute;
	top:0px;
	left:0px;
	width:100%;
	height:100%;
	border:0;
	padding:0;
	margin:0;
	z-index:60;
	display:none;
}
/* The slices in the Slider */
.nivo-slice {
	display:block;
	position:absolute;
	z-index:50;
	height:100%;
}
/* Caption styles */
.nivo-caption {
	position:absolute;
	left:0px;
	bottom:0px;
	background:#fff;
	color:#000;
	opacity:0.75; /* Overridden by captionOpacity setting */
	width:100%;
	z-index:89;
}
.nivo-caption p {
	padding:5px;
	margin:0;
}

.nivo-caption h5 {
	padding:5px 0 0 5px;
	margin:0;
	color: #000;
}

.nivo-caption a {
	display:inline !important;
}
.nivo-html-caption {
    display:none;
}
/* Direction nav styles (e.g. Next & Prev) */
.nivo-directionNav a {
	position:absolute;
	top:45%;
	z-index:99;
	cursor:pointer;
}
.nivo-prevNav {
	left:0px;
	background: url(../images/pg/arrows.png) no-repeat 10px 0;
	width: 30px;
	height: 30px;
	padding: 0 0 0 10px;
	text-indent: -9999px;
}
.nivo-nextNav {
	right:0px;
	background: url(../images/pg/arrows.png) no-repeat -30px 0;
	width: 30px;
	height: 30px;
	padding: 0 0 0 10px;
	text-indent: -9999px;
}
/* Control nav styles (e.g. 1,2,3...) */
.nivo-controlNav a {
	position:relative;
	cursor:pointer;
	float: left;
}


.nivo-controlNav a.active {
border: none;
}


.nivo-controlNav a.active img {
opacity: 1.0;
}

/* END */

#slider-wrapper {
width: 490px;
height: 260px;
padding: 0 0 0 20px;
}


#slider-wrapper_outter {
width: 100%;
margin: auto;
padding: 20px 0 10px 0;
background: #fff;
}

.nivoSlider .nivo-controlNav img {
position: relative;
margin: 0 0 5px 0;
opacity: 0.3;
}

.nivo-controlNav img:hover {
opacity: 1.0;
}


.nivo-controlNav {
    float: left;
    padding: 0 0 0 540px;
    position: absolute;
    height: 260px;
}


#imageDataContainer img { margin-bottom: 0; }
#imageDataContainer {overflow:hidden}


